Understanding Your Second DWI Offense: Penalties and Implications
A second Driving While Intoxicated (DWI) charge is significantly more serious than a first offense. Across most jurisdictions, judges and prosecutors view repeat offenders with increased scrutiny, leading to harsher penalties designed to deter future violations. While specific laws vary by state, you can generally expect:
- Mandatory Jail Time: Unlike many first offenses that might offer alternatives, a second DWI almost always carries a minimum mandatory jail sentence, which can range from several days to several months, or even a year.
- Extended License Suspension: Your driving privileges will likely be suspended for a much longer period, often 1-2 years or more. Reinstatement typically involves hefty fees and specific requirements.
- Ignition Interlock Device (IID): You will almost certainly be required to install an Ignition Interlock Device in your vehicle for an extended period after your suspension, sometimes even during a probationary period after jail time.
- Significantly Higher Fines: Fines for a second DWI can be thousands of dollars, placing a substantial financial burden on you.
- Mandatory Alcohol Education and Treatment Programs: Courts often mandate participation in intensive alcohol education or substance abuse treatment programs at your own expense.
- Increased Insurance Rates: A second DWI conviction will skyrocket your auto insurance premiums, potentially making coverage difficult or unaffordable for years.
- Criminal Record Impact: A second DWI conviction can have long-lasting effects on your employment prospects, housing, and social standing.

Effective Defense Strategies for a Second DWI Charge
While challenging, a second DWI charge is not insurmountable with the right defense. An experienced attorney will explore various avenues to defend your case:
- Challenging the Initial Stop: Was there a legitimate reason for the police to pull you over? If not, any evidence gathered afterward might be inadmissible.
- Disputing Field Sobriety Tests (FSTs): FSTs are subjective and can be influenced by factors like fatigue, medical conditions, or even footwear. An attorney can argue their inaccuracy.
- Questioning Breathalyzer Accuracy: Devices can be improperly calibrated, used incorrectly, or influenced by factors like mouth alcohol or medical conditions. Your attorney can challenge the scientific validity of the results. Learn more about devices like the Ignition Interlock Device here.
- Analyzing Blood Test Procedures: Errors in collection, storage, or analysis of blood samples can lead to inaccurate results, which an attorney will investigate thoroughly.
- Violation of Rights: Were your Miranda rights read? Was there probable cause for arrest? Any violation of your constitutional rights can be grounds for dismissal or reduction of charges.
- Negotiating Plea Bargains: In some cases, a plea bargain to a lesser charge or alternative sentencing (like house arrest or an extended IID period instead of jail) might be the best outcome, especially if the evidence against you is strong.

Frequently Asked Questions About Second Offense DWI
Will I automatically go to jail for a second DWI?
While many states mandate minimum jail time for a second DWI, it’s not always automatic. An experienced attorney can explore options like house arrest, intense probation, or inpatient treatment programs in lieu of traditional incarceration, depending on the specifics of your case and local laws. However, be prepared for a strong possibility of jail time.
How long will my license be suspended after a second DWI?
License suspension periods for a second DWI are typically much longer than for a first offense, often ranging from 1 to 2 years, or even more. The exact duration depends on your state’s laws, previous offenses, and the specific circumstances of your arrest. Reinstatement usually involves fees, specific courses, and often an Ignition Interlock Device (IID).
Can I refuse a breathalyzer test for a second offense?
Most states have “implied consent” laws, meaning by driving on public roads, you implicitly agree to chemical testing if suspected of DWI. Refusing a breathalyzer, especially on a second offense, often leads to immediate, longer license suspension penalties separate from any court conviction, and prosecutors may use your refusal as evidence of guilt.
